Its the first time ive used one, i know what you mean about the weight but it didnt seem that heavy while i was using it, you dont need to put any pressure on it, just help it glide over the panels. I only used it to apply my paint cleaner and polish, i still took the products off with a micro fibre and applied my p21s with the applicator you get with it. To be honest it did that good of a job i found it harder to get the product off with the microfibre. Took alot more rubbing anyway.
Not sure on the pad sizes, as i said its the first one ive used. They are about 8-10" wide once stretched over the polisher, i think there about average size and you can order more from the card thats in the box or from the website.
